Cynthia Erivo's Biography

Cynthia Erivo is a renowned actress and singer known for her groundbreaking performances in theater, film, and television. Born on January 8, 1987, in London, England, she rose to prominence through her role as Celie in the Broadway revival of "The Color Purple," earning critical acclaim and numerous awards.

Clarifying Cynthia's Health Status

There is no credible evidence or official statement suggesting that Cynthia Erivo has ever been diagnosed with cancer. Her health remains private, and she has not publicly addressed any serious medical issues.
